Twilio Announces Winner of “One in a Twilion” Award


 

In the lead up to International Women’s Day, Twilio announces Ingrid Sierra, Chief Marketing Officer at Finfare as the recipient of this award

LONDON, March 5, 2025 Twilio (NYSE: TWLO), the customer engagement platform that drives real-time, personalised experiences for today’s leading brands, announced the winner of its ‘One in a Twilion’ award. 

‘One in a Twilion’ honours women's impact in technology teams. Submissions were open to the public, inviting nominations for women in tech who have driven brilliant work and results for their teams and businesses. The nominations were judged by a panel of Twilio executives, including Sam Richardson, Director of Executive Engagement Programs for EMEA and APJ; Camelia Suciu, Director of Solutions Engineering for EMEA; and, Inbal Shani, Chief Product Officer & Head of R&D. 

The award announcement follows Twilio’s recently announced partnership with Chelsea Football Club, which inspired its creation. Inbal Shani, Chief Product Officer at Twilio said: “We saw this inaugural award as the perfect opportunity to celebrate the technical talent of women on and off the field. Whether through demonstrating leadership, coaching young talent, or guiding innovative strategy, there are plenty of builders who deserve more recognition for the value they bring to their teams. Personally, I felt inspired while reading stories of real grit from the nominated women across walks of life, from healthcare to financial services and technology startups.”

With excellent and inspirational nominations received from across the globe, the judges selected Ingrid Sierra, Chief Marketing Officer at Finfare, as the winner.

Ingrid is an accomplished leader with over 20 years of global marketing experience, specialising in B2B and B2C strategies. She has demonstrated a strong track record of driving revenue growth and enhancing lifetime customer value for various international organisations. With her visionary leadership style, Ingrid has excelled in building and nurturing high-performing marketing functions by fostering a culture of empowerment and trust. Her extensive skill set includes expertise in brand strategy, customer lifecycle management, digital marketing, sales enablement, and data analytics, among others.

As CMO of Finfare, Ingrid plays an instrumental part in establishing and leading a team in California, focusing on brand positioning, product marketing, and user experience to solidify Finfare's standing as a leading fintech and rewards provider. Previously, she held influential positions at the loyalty technology platform Tenerity and The Carphone Warehouse, where she made significant contributions to marketing and customer experience strategies. In addition to her professional achievements, Ingrid is actively engaged in mentoring programs.

About Chelsea Football Club

Chelsea Football Club is one of the top football clubs globally and its men’s team were the FIFA Club World Cup winners for 2021, beating Brazilian side Palmeiras in the final in Abu Dhabi, held in 2022 due to the pandemic. That success followed winning the UEFA Champions League for a second time in 2021 with victory over Manchester City in Porto.

Founded in 1905, Chelsea is London’s most central football club, based at the iconic 40,000-capacity Stamford Bridge stadium. Nicknamed ‘The Blues’, the club lifted the Champions League trophy for the first time in 2012 and has also won the Premier League five times, the FA Cup eight times, the Football League Cup five times, the UEFA Europa League twice, the UEFA Cup Winners’ Cup twice, the UEFA Super Cup twice and the Football League Championship once, in 1955.

The 2021 Champions League and Super Cup triumphs ensured Chelsea became the first club to win four major UEFA club competitions twice, following its earlier successes in those two competitions as well as the Europa League and Cup Winners’ Cup. 

The Chelsea Women’s team have enjoyed a huge amount of success and in 2024 won the FA Women’s Super League for a fifth consecutive year and the seventh time overall. The Women’s FA Cup has been won on five occasions. The side has also captured the FA Women’s League Cup twice as well as reaching the UEFA Women’s Champions League final in 2021.

In addition to possessing some of the world’s most recognisable players, Chelsea has also invested in its future with a state-of-the-art Academy and training centre in Cobham, Surrey. Since the Academy building’s opening in 2008, the club has won seven FA Youth Cups, back-to-back UEFA Youth League titles in 2015 and 2016, and the U23 and U18 Premier League national championships most recently in 2019/20 and 2017/18 respectively. 

The Chelsea Foundation boasts one of the most extensive community initiatives in sport, helping to improve the lives of children and young people all over the world.
